The summer promises to be hectic at OM, after the club failed to even reach Europe last season. Indeed, by finishing eighth in Ligue 1, the Marseillais ended their season in the worst possible way and closed a very complicated 2023/2024 season for the club and the supporters. Without European competition, some of the squad’s executives could then choose to leave the south of France.

Pau Lopez to Italy?

Under contract until June 2026 with OM, the former Roma goalkeeper has finished his third and potentially final season in the Phocaean city. The 29-year-old Spaniard is of interest to Como, recently promoted to Serie A, as well as Genoa, who are set to lose Josep Martinez, their starting goalkeeper. Gianluca Di Marzio even announced that some Spanish clubs would be interested. Nothing has been decided yet, but this matter will have to be followed closely. In any case, it would be a huge blow for Pablo Longoria and OM.
